When you export the translation patterns, you'll be given a .tar file with two files in it. the first is a file called hearder.txt and the second will be called translationpattern.csv.
The header.txt file references the filename translationpattern.csv so make sure you save you're new file with the same name and your new patterns are in the .csv file. Use QuickZip or something and create a new .tar file with the two files in it (header.txt and translationpattern.csv). upload these to callmanager via Bulk Administration --> upload/download files. You can validate your file prior to importing to save yourself some headache.

Does your import habe to contain all TP you exported or can just contain TPs you want to add.

Only the new ones. You can import the old ones, but it would be a waste of resources to overwrite the configuration when there is no change. But this is a good question, because now you also know, that if you need to change all TP in your system, an export, modify, import procedure would do just that. Good luck.
